Factors Affecting Cost

House raising in Hartland, WI, involves elevating a home to protect it from flooding, improve foundation stability, or prepare for future modifications. This process requires careful planning and coordination to ensure the structure is safely lifted and supported during and after the project.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ners compare options and estimate costs effectively.

  • Materials used for jacking and support structures, such as steel beams and cribbing, which must meet safety and durability standards.
  • Project scope varies based on house size, foundation type, and the complexity of the existing structure, influencing overall effort and resources needed.
  • Labor complexity depends on house design, foundation condition, and the presence of utilities or additional features that may require special handling.
  • Permitting requirements in Hartland, WI, typically involve local building codes and inspections to ensure compliance throughout the process.
  • Additional services may include foundation repairs, utility adjustments, or modifications to meet new elevation levels, affecting project scope and cost.

Project Size and Complexity

Scope/Size Typical Range
Single-story home (1,200-1,800 sq ft) $15,000 - $30,000
Two-story home (2,000-3,000 sq ft) $25,000 - $50,000
Basement or foundation work included $5,000 - $15,000 additional
Additional elevation for flood zones Varies based on height and complexity
Accessory structures or additions Cost varies based on size and scope

In Hartland, WI, house raising projects typically fall within these ranges, depending on the home's size and specific site conditions.
